Abstract

The paper presents analyses of fibre reinforced polymer (FRP) samples with embedded fibre Bragg grating (FBG) sensors. As a reinforcement glass or carbon fibres in a form of textiles with different grammage and bundles fibre arrangement were used. All samples were manufactured using infusion method. FBG sensors are applied for analyses of strain distribution inside sample due to static point loads. Samples internal structures were analysed using THz spectroscopy. Analyses of possibility of detection and localisation of fibre optics lying under textile or embedded into carbon/glass FRP are performed. For carbon FRP the maximal depth of inspection is determined. The THz wave propagation depth depends on conductive carbon fibres arrangement in non-conductive resin matrix.
